Understanding Science Bowl Competitions



What is a Science Bowl?



A Science Bowl is a quiz competition for high school students that emphasizes knowledge in various scientific fields. It usually consists of teams of four students who work together to answer questions posed by a moderator. The questions can range from easy to very difficult, and the format is designed to be fast-paced to keep contestants engaged and on their toes.

Structure of a Science Bowl



Science Bowl competitions typically follow a structured format:

1. Team Composition:
- Each team usually consists of four members, with an optional alternate.
- Teams can be formed from individual schools or represent a combination of schools.

2. Rounds:
- The competition is divided into preliminary rounds and knockout rounds.
- In preliminary rounds, teams compete in a series of matches, and the top teams advance to the playoff rounds.

3. Scoring:
- Teams earn points for correct answers and may lose points for incorrect ones, depending on the specific rules of the competition.
- The team with the highest score at the end of the match wins.

4. Timing:
- Each question is usually timed, requiring teams to respond quickly.

Types of Questions



Science Bowl questions can be categorized into several types:

1. Multiple Choice Questions:
- These questions provide several answer choices, allowing students to select the correct one.
- Example: "What is the primary gas in Earth's atmosphere? A) Oxygen B) Nitrogen C) Carbon Dioxide"

2. Short Answer Questions:
- These require a brief response, often just a word or a phrase.
- Example: "What is the chemical symbol for gold?"

3. True/False Questions:
- Contestants must determine if a statement is correct or incorrect.
- Example: "True or False: Water is a compound made of two hydrogen atoms and one oxygen atom."

4. Problem Solving Questions:
- These questions require students to solve a mathematical or scientific problem.
- Example: "Calculate the wavelength of a wave with a frequency of 500 Hz."

5. Visual Questions:
- Teams may be shown images, diagrams, or graphs and asked to interpret or analyze them.
- Example: "Refer to the diagram of a cell and identify the organelle responsible for energy production."

Preparing for Science Bowl Competitions



Study Strategies



Preparation for science bowl competitions is essential for success. Here are some effective study strategies:

1. Review Core Concepts:
- Focus on fundamental principles in biology, chemistry, physics, and earth science.
- Use textbooks, online resources, and educational videos for comprehensive reviews.

2. Utilize Practice Questions:
- Engage with past science bowl questions and similar quiz formats.
- Many organizations provide archives of previous questions that can be used for practice.

3. Form Study Groups:
- Collaborate with teammates to discuss challenging topics.
- Group study can foster deeper understanding and retention of information.

4. Attend Workshops and Camps:
- Participate in workshops or summer camps focused on science bowl preparation.
- These often include expert guidance and mock competitions.

5. Focus on Weak Areas:
- Identify specific topics where team members feel less confident and allocate extra study time to those areas.

Effective Teamwork



Science bowl competitions emphasize the importance of teamwork. Here are some tips for effective collaboration:

1. Assign Roles:
- Designate roles based on team members' strengths, such as a biology expert, a math whiz, etc.
- Having clear roles can enhance efficiency during competitions.

2. Practice Together:
- Regular practice sessions can help build team chemistry and improve communication.
- Simulate competition conditions to familiarize the team with the pressure of timed responses.

3. Develop a Strategy:
- Create a plan for how to approach questions during competitions.
- Discuss when to buzz in and how to handle challenging questions.

4. Encourage Open Communication:
- Foster an environment where team members feel comfortable sharing ideas and opinions.
- Encourage respectful discussions, especially when debating answers.

Is there a national science bowl competition for high school students?

Yes, the National Science Bowl is an annual competition sponsored by the U.S. Department of Energy, where high school teams compete in science knowledge and problem-solving.
